Detailed explanation-1: -The performance of the network is also tied to the central node’s configurations and performance. Star topologies are easy to manage in most ways but they are far from cheap to set up and use.

Detailed explanation-2: -Requires more cable length than a linear bus topology. If the connecting network device (network switch) fails, nodes attached are disabled and cannot participate in computer network communication. More expensive than linear bus topology because of the cost of the connecting devices (network switches).

Detailed explanation-3: -Disadvantages of Star Topology Highly dependent on the central device: If the hub goes down, everything goes down as none of the devices can work without a hub. The drawback is if the central device fails, the whole network goes down.
